Month-by-Month rehabilitation Guide
This timeline provides a general overview. Individual rehabilitation can vary based on the specific injury, surgical procedure, and adherence to rehabilitation protocols. Your orthopedic surgeon and physical therapist in Istanbul will provide a personalized plan.
Month 1: Initial Healing and pain management
The first month focuses on controlling pain and swelling, protecting the surgical site. initiating gentle, passive range of motion exercises as guided by your therapist. Crutches or other assistive devices will likely be used, and strenuous activity is strictly prohibited. You can expect to remain in Istanbul for the initial phase of your rehabilitation, typically 2-4 weeks, to ensure proper wound healing. begin physical therapy under direct supervision. This early stage is important, with around 80% of initial healing occurring within these first few weeks.
Months 2-3: Restoring Mobility and Strength

💬 Compare My Savings on WhatsAppAs pain subsides, the focus shifts to gradually increasing active range of motion and introducing light strengthening exercises. Low-impact activities like swimming or cycling (stationary) may be introduced. You'll likely be discharged from the hospital and can continue rehabilitation at home or with a local physical therapist. Avoiding any twisting or sudden movements is very important. At this stage, approximately 50-60% of functional rehabilitation is typically achieved, but the joint is still vulnerable.
Months 4-6: Building Endurance and Sport-Specific Training
This period involves more progressive strengthening, endurance training, and the gradual introduction of sport-specific movements. Light jogging or plyometric exercises might be incorporated. Full return to competitive sport is generally not advised yet. Pain-free movement is the goal, with around 70-80% of pre-injury strength and function expected. Continued dedication to your physical therapy program is key.
Months 7-12: Return to Full Activity and Injury Prevention
By month seven, many individuals can gradually return to their sport at full intensity, provided they have met all rehabilitation milestones. their surgeon or physical therapist gives clearance. The focus shifts to maintaining strength, flexibility, and addressing any biomechanical issues to prevent future injuries. The final 10-20% of rehabilitation is often approximately regaining complete confidence and skill execution.
What to Avoid During rehabilitation
Throughout your rehabilitation, it is important to avoid: strenuous activities beyond your prescribed exercises, high-impact movements,. twisting or rotational forces on the injured area, smoking (which impairs healing), excessive weight gain. neglecting physical therapy. Listen to your body and never push through sharp or increasing pain
Signs of Complications and When to Seek Medical Attention
While complications are rare in Istanbul's reputable sports medicine centers, be vigilant for: increasing or severe pain. significant swelling that doesn't improve, redness or warmth around the surgical site, fever, discharge from the wound, numbness or tingling that persists or worsens. a sudden loss of function. Contact your surgeon or medical team immediately if you experience any of these
